Specifications
Comparison of all specifications
GeForce RTX 2080 SUPER | SpecificationsComparison of all specifications | Radeon VII |
---|---|---|
General | ||
Jul 23rd, 2019 | Release Date | Feb 7th, 2019 |
$699.00 | MSRP | $699.00 |
GeForce 20 | Generation | Vega II |
Desktop | Segment | Desktop |
250 W | Power Consumption | 295 W |
Memory | ||
8 GB | Memory Size | 16 GB |
GDDR6 | Memory Type | HBM2 |
256-bit | Memory Bus | 4096-bit |
495.9 GB/s | Bandwidth | 1020 GB/s |
Theoretical Performance | ||
116.2 GPixel/s | Pixel Fillrate | 112 GPixel/s |
348.5 GTexel/s | Texture Fillrate | 420 GTexel/s |
11.15 TFLOPS | FP32 | 13.44 TFLOPS |
